We explored whether bilingual toddlers make use of semantic and phonological overlap between their languages to learn new words. We analysed cross-sectional and longitudinal CDI data on the words understood and produced by 1.0 to 3.0-year-old bilingual toddlers with English and one additional language. Cognates were more likely to be understood and produced compared to non-cognates. Cognate effects were modulated by whether the toddler knew the translation equivalent in the other language, highlighting that young learners are sensitive to the similarities across their languages. Additionally, exploratory analyses suggest that children with smaller vocabularies rely more on translation equivalents to support the acquisition of difficult words. Children with larger vocabulary sizes exhibited no preference for translation equivalents in comprehension, and a preference for new concepts in production. The rapid acceleration of vocabulary growth in the second year of life may explain this developmental change in translation equivalent preference.
This study examined the influence of letter transpositions on morphological facilitation in L1 English and L1 Chinese-L2 English speakers. Morphological priming effects were investigated by comparing morphologically complex primes that either contained transposed-letters (TL) within the stem or across the morpheme boundary, relative to a substituted-letter (SL) control. Within two masked primed lexical decision experiments, the same stem targets were preceded by morphologically related, TL-within, SL-within, TL-across, SL-across, or unrelated primes. Reaction time analyses with morphologically intact primes revealed facilitation in both L1 and L2 English. In L1, TL-within priming was significant, while the magnitude of TL-across priming varied as a function of positional specific bigram frequency and spelling proficiency. In L2, TL-priming was entirely absent. These findings support models of complex word recognition that accommodate relative flexibility in letter position encoding.
Chapter 4 is an extensive study of runaway slave advertisements that mention that a slave speaks Dutch. For this chapter, I have compiled a database of 487 enslaved persons, coded by year of flight, name, age, Dutch language ability, name of master, county, and original source. I demonstrate that runaway slave advertisements in New York City and environs plateaued in the period 1760–1800, but peaked later in the Hudson Valley, with exceptional growth in the 1790s and 1800s. The data provide evidence for the persistence of the Dutch language in New York and New Jersey and contribute to a picture of Dutch-speaking slaves presenting a sharp economic challenge to the institution of slavery. By the 1790s, Dutch-speaking slaves were running away at a rate of at least 1 per 500 per year. For Dutch slave owners, this meant a significant loss of capital and, moreover, a risk on their remaining slave capital. Runaway slaves tended to be prime working-age males, and the loss of the best field workers frustrated New York Dutch farmers. The pressure of runaway activity also lowered the value of retained slaves and made New York slavery more costly in general. Runaways put pressure on slaveholders to manumit their slaves, extracting the most labor possible from them before agreeing to let them go.

Metaphor processing has been mostly researched using the space–valence paradigm, where participants respond to either space–valence congruent or incongruent stimuli. Little attention has, however, been devoted to the role of valence–space associations in bilingual orientational metaphor comprehension. Here, we employed a reaction time method and tested Polish (L1) – English (L2) highly proficient bilinguals, who performed a metaphoricity judgment task to L1 and L2 conceptual metaphoric sentences that were either valence–space congruent (BAD IS DOWN and GOOD IS UP) or incongruent (BAD IS UP and GOOD IS DOWN). The results showed a valence effect, where negatively valenced sentences were evaluated more accurately than positively valenced stimuli. We also found an interaction between valence, congruency and language, such that in both L1 and L2, negatively and positively valenced congruent metaphors were easier and faster to process than those violating the space–valence congruency. Altogether, this study provides a more embodied and experientially grounded approach to studying human cognition, lending credence to the automatic activation of primary metaphorical mappings in the human mind.
The present study examined whether length of bilingual experience and language ability contributed to cross-situational word learning (XSWL) in Spanish-English bilingual school-aged children. We contrasted performance in a high variability condition, where children were exposed to multiple speakers and exemplars simultaneously, to performance in a condition where children were exposed to no variability in either speakers or exemplars. Results revealed graded effects of bilingualism and language ability on XSWL under conditions of increased variability. Specifically, bilingualism bolstered learning when variability was present in the input but not when variability was absent in the input. Similarly, robust language abilities supported learning in the high variability condition. In contrast, children with weaker language skills learned more word-object associations in the no variability condition than in the high variability condition. Together, the results suggest that variation in the learner and variation in the input interact and modulate mechanisms of lexical learning in children.
This study longitudinally modeled home language exposure patterns of US Spanish–English bilingual children between the ages of 4 and 12. Participants were 280 Spanish–English bilinguals (95% Hispanic, 52% female) who were followed for up to 5 years using a cross-sequential longitudinal design. Multilevel linear regression models were used to estimate language exposure trajectories across four home language sources (adults, peers, electronic media and literacy activities) and three language modes (Spanish-only, English-only and bilingual). Results demonstrated that Spanish interactions with both adults and peers declined as children aged, while bilingual interactions showed a distinct increase over time. Conversely, media exposure and engagement in literacy activities increased over time, irrespective of the language used. Children’s age of first English exposure and current school English exposure also influenced language contact and use in the home. These findings approximate an 8-year exposure trajectory across a continuum of bilingual experiences.
We investigated the extent to which executive functions (EFs) are recruited in language switching in children in a cued picture-naming (CN) task. We expected to find associations between CN and EF tasks measuring inhibitory control and shifting. Another goal was to compare parent-reported children’s everyday language control ability at home with their switching ability in the CN task and EF performance. The participants were mostly 5–7-year-old Norwegian–Spanish and Finnish–Swedish-speaking children (N = 45). The analysis was preregistered. Unexpectedly, the primary accuracy analysis showed positive associations between CN switching costs and EF performance in only one of the EF tests, flanker, and CN mixing costs were predicted only by the color-shape switch costs. Children’s everyday language control ability did not show consistent significant associations with lab measures. Our study provides weak evidence for the view that EFs are engaged in language control when children have some years of bilingual experience.
There is evidence to suggest that the effects of bilingualism on executive functions (EFs) need to be examined along a continuum rather than a dichotomy. The present study addressed this need by examining the influence of different bilingual experiences on executive functioning using a Flanker and Stroop mouse-tracking task that taps into more dynamic cognitive processes than typical behavioral paradigms. We sampled 98 bilingual young adults and investigated conflict and sequential congruency effects (SCEs). We found that mouse-tracking metrics captured links that were not identified with overall reaction times. SCEs were more sensitive to detecting relations between L2 experiences and EF than simple conflict effects. Second-language age of acquisition and L1/L2 switching frequency consistently predicted EF outcomes. This association was moderated by the attentional demands of the task. These findings highlight the complexity of the effects of bilingualism on cognition, and the use of more sensitive measures to capture these effects.
English as a second language (L2) has become the medium of instruction in numerous contexts even though many people may have difficulties to read and study in L2. According to the self-regulated framework, metacognitive strategies are essential to achieve successful learning, but they are resource-consuming and their use might be compromised in demanding contexts such as learning in L2. In Experiment 1, nonbalanced bilinguals read high- and low-cohesion texts in L1 and L2 and self-rated their learning using a judgment of learning (JOL). Then, they answered open-ended questions and responded a customized questionnaire regarding their strategies. In Experiment 2, we introduced two bilingual groups varying in L2 proficiency. Overall, participants could adjust their JOLs and detect the difficulty of the texts correctly in L1 and L2. However, results evidenced some nuances in learning strategies related to L2 proficiency. We discuss these findings within the context of the self-regulated learning.
This study investigated the role of temperament in oral language development in over 200 Mandarin and Cantonese speakers in the Growing Up in New Zealand pre-birth longitudinal cohort study. Mothers assessed infant temperament at nine months using a five-factor Infant Behaviour Questionnaire-Revised Very Short Form. They also reported on children’s vocabulary and word combinations at age two using adapted MacArthur-Bates Communicative Development Inventory short forms. Regression analyses were employed to examine unique links between infant temperament and language, respectively, controlling for demographic factors. Fear was associated with larger English vocabularies for English-Mandarin speakers and larger Cantonese vocabularies for Cantonese speakers. Orienting capacity was associated with more advanced word combinations for Mandarin speakers, whereas negative emotionality was associated with less advanced word combinations for Cantonese speakers. Positive affect/surgency was associated with more advanced word combinations for English-Cantonese speakers. This study revealed predictive patterns of infant temperament across Chinese-speaking children’s multiple languages.
Can exposure to a foreign language in the first year of school enhance divergent thinking skills? Ninety-nine monolingual children from predominantly White neighbourhoods (MAge = 57.7 months, SD 1.2; 47 girls) attending bilingual schools, schools with weekly foreign language lessons, or schools without a foreign language provision (= controls) completed divergent thinking and executive function tasks at the beginning of the school year and 24 weeks later. The groups did not differ on creativity measures at the beginning of the school year. Only bilingual school children and weekly language learners improved divergent thinking at the second testing point, with the former significantly outperforming controls on creative fluency and flexibility. Improvements could not be explained by executive function development. Therefore, a considerable amount of exposure to a foreign language in early formal education appears to boost creative thinking.
Schizophrenia impacts several cognitive systems including language. Linguistic symptoms of schizophrenia are important to understand due to the crucial role that language plays in the diagnostic and treatment process. However, the literature is heavily based on monolingual-centric research. Multilinguals demonstrate differences from monolinguals in language cognition. When someone with schizophrenia is multilingual, how do these differences interact with their symptoms? To address this question, we conducted a pre-registered PRISMA-SR scoping review to determine themes in the literature and identify gaps for future research. Four hundred and twenty records were identified from three databases in 2023. Thirty articles were included in the synthesis. We found three emergent themes: (1) the need for multilingual treatment options, (2) differences in symptomology between the L1 and L2, and (3) the impact of cultural factors on linguistic functioning. Thus, several avenues of research regarding multilingualism may be fruitful for improving linguistic and social outcomes in schizophrenia.
We tested whether verb-based prediction in late bilinguals is facilitated when the verb is a cognate versus non-cognate. Spanish–English bilinguals and Chinese–English bilinguals (control) listened to English sentences such as “The girl will adopt the dog” while viewing a scene containing either a dog and unadoptable objects (predictable condition) or a dog and other adoptable animals (unpredictable condition). The verb was either a cognate or non-cognate between Spanish and English and never a cognate between Chinese and English. Both groups of bilinguals were more likely to look at the target (the dog) in the predictable versus unpredictable condition. However, only low-proficient L1 Spanish bilinguals showed greater and earlier prediction when the verb was cognate than when it was non-cognate, suggesting that cognate facilitation effect occurs not only on the cognate word itself but also on prediction based on this cognate word, and that this effect is modulated by L2 proficiency.
We report findings from a corpus-based investigation of three young children growing up in German-English bilingual environments (M = 3;0, Range = 2;3–3;11). Based on 2,146,179 single words and two-word combinations in naturalistic child speech (CS) and child-directed speech (CDS), we assessed the degree to which the frequency distribution of CDS predicted CS usage over time, and systematically identified CS that was over- or underrepresented in the corpus with respect to matched CDS baselines. Results showed that CDS explained 61% of the variance in CS single-word use and 19.3% of the variance in two-word combinations. Furthermore, the bilingual nature of the over or -underrepresented CS was partially attributable to factors beyond the corpus statistics, namely individual differences between children in their bilingual learning environment. In two out of the three children, overrepresented two-word combinations contained higher levels of syntactic slot redundancy than underrepresented CS. These results are discussed with respect to the role that redundancy plays in producing semiformulaic slot-and-frame patterns in CS.
The classical language switching paradigm using arbitrary cues to indicate the language to speak in has revealed switching between languages comes at a cost (i.e., switch cost) and makes one slower in the first than in the second language (i.e., reversed language dominance). However, arbitrary cues can create artificial requirements not present during everyday language interactions. Therefore, we investigated whether simulating elements of real-life conversations with question cues (‘Co?’ versus ‘What?’) facilitates language switching in comparison to the classical paradigm (Experiment 1: red versus blue outline; Experiments 2 and 3: low versus high tone). We revealed a dissociation between the two indices of language control: (1) question cues, compared to arbitrary cues, reduced switch costs but (2) did not modulate (in Experiment 1) or increase the reversed language dominance (Experiments 2 and 3). We propose that this conversational switching paradigm could be used as a conceptually more ‘true’ measure of language control.
This study investigated the impact of reading statements in a second language (L2) versus the first language (L1) on core knowledge confusion (CKC), superstition, and conspiracy beliefs. Previous research on the Foreign Language Effect (FLE) suggests that using an L2 elicits less intense emotional reactions, promotes rational decision-making, reduces risk aversion, causality bias and superstition alters the perception of dishonesty and crime, and increases tolerance of ambiguity. Our results do not support the expected FLE and found instead an effect of L2 proficiency: Participants with lower proficiency exhibited more CKC, were more superstitious and believed more in conspiracy theories, regardless of whether they were tested in L1 or L2. The study emphasises the importance of considering L2 proficiency when investigating the effect of language on decision-making and judgements: It—or related factors—may influence how material is judged, contributing to the FLE, or even creating an artificial effect.
The current research aims to predict L1 Papiamento and L2 Dutch reading comprehension development in 180 children in the upper primary grades (4–6) in a post-colonial Caribbean context from initial language of decoding instruction, cognitive and linguistic child characteristics, and linguistic transfer. Overall, children showed better reading comprehension proficiency in L1 as compared to L2 Dutch. Over the grades, strong autoregression effects in reading comprehension development in both languages were evidenced. Language of decoding instruction was found to predict L2 reading comprehension, but not L1 reading comprehension. The development of L2 reading comprehension showed better outcomes in the case of initial decoding instruction in L2. Word decoding, reading vocabulary, and grammar in respectively L1 and L2 were related to L1 and L2 reading comprehension in Grade 4, while L2 reading comprehension was additionally related to L2 basic oral vocabulary. Moreover, only reading vocabulary was related to L1 and L2 reading comprehension development across the grades. Finally, evidence of cross-linguistic interdependencies in the development of reading comprehension in L1 and L2 was found.
Little is known about the interplay between the language of operation and gender stereotype processing. In this study, Polish–English (L1–L2) male and female bilinguals made meaningfulness judgments on L1 and L2 stereotypically congruent and incongruent as well as semantically correct and incorrect sentences. The results showed gender- and language-dependent modulations by sentence type within the N400 and Late Positive Complex (LPC) time frames. In females, semantically correct sentences converged with stereotypically congruent and incongruent conditions in both languages, indicating a deep-rooted internalization of gender stereotype-laden content. Conversely, males displayed a heightened gender-stereotypical bias only in L1. In L2, they exhibited a reduced sensitivity to gender stereotypes, whereby semantically incorrect sentences converged with both stereotypically congruent and incongruent conditions in the N400 time window and with stereotypically incongruent sentences in the LPC time frame. Altogether, the study extends the foreign language effect to the context of bilingual gender stereotype processing.
Whether speaking two or more languages (multilingualism) or dialects of one language (bidialectalism) affect executive function (EF) is controversial. Theoretically, these effects may depend on at least two conditions. First, the multilingual and bidialectal characteristics; particularly, (second) language proficiency and the sociolinguistic context of language use (e.g., Green & Abutalebi, 2013). Second, the EF aspects examined; specifically, recent accounts of the locus of the multilingual effect propose a general EF effect rather than an impact on specific processes (Bialystok, 2017). We compared 52 “monolingual” (with limited additional-language/dialect experience), 79 bidialectal and 50 multilingual young adults in the diglossic context of Cyprus, where bidialectalism is widespread and Cypriot and Standard Greek are used in different everyday situations. Three EF processes were examined via seven tasks: inhibition, switching and working memory (Miyake et al., 2000). We found better multilingual and bidialectal performance in overall EF, an effect moderated by high (second) language proficiency.
